...
|
...
|
@@ -106,6 +106,8 @@ func (translator *UserTranslator) ToRelevantFromRepresentation(user *UserDetail) |
|
|
UserAccount: "",
|
|
|
},
|
|
|
UserType: user.UserType,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
Status: user.EnableStatus,
|
|
|
Company: &domain.Company{
|
|
|
CompanyId: user.Company.CompanyId,
|
...
|
...
|
@@ -119,13 +121,15 @@ func (translator *UserTranslator) ToReferrerFromRepresentation(user *UserDetail) |
|
|
return &domain.Referrer{
|
|
|
UserId: user.UserId,
|
|
|
UserBaseId: user.UserBaseId,
|
|
|
Role: nil,
|
|
|
Roles: nil,
|
|
|
Orgs: nil,
|
|
|
Org: nil,
|
|
|
Department: nil,
|
|
|
Company: nil,
|
|
|
UserInfo: nil,
|
|
|
UserType: 0,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
}, nil
|
|
|
}
|
|
|
|
...
|
...
|
@@ -139,6 +143,8 @@ func (translator *UserTranslator) ToUndertakerFromRepresentation(user *UserDetai |
|
|
Roles: nil,
|
|
|
UserInfo: nil,
|
|
|
UserType: 0,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
Status: 0,
|
|
|
Company: nil,
|
|
|
ContractAttachment: nil,
|
...
|
...
|
@@ -149,13 +155,15 @@ func (translator *UserTranslator) ToSalesmanFromRepresentation(user *UserDetail) |
|
|
return &domain.Salesman{
|
|
|
UserId: user.UserId,
|
|
|
UserBaseId: user.UserBaseId,
|
|
|
Role: nil,
|
|
|
Roles: nil,
|
|
|
Orgs: nil,
|
|
|
Org: nil,
|
|
|
Department: nil,
|
|
|
Company: nil,
|
|
|
UserInfo: nil,
|
|
|
UserType: 0,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
}, nil
|
|
|
}
|
|
|
|
...
|
...
|
@@ -166,9 +174,11 @@ func (translator *UserTranslator) ToOperatorFromRepresentation(user *UserDetail) |
|
|
Org: nil,
|
|
|
Orgs: nil,
|
|
|
Department: nil,
|
|
|
Role: nil,
|
|
|
Roles: nil,
|
|
|
UserInfo: nil,
|
|
|
UserType: 0,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
Status: 0,
|
|
|
Company: nil,
|
|
|
}, nil
|
...
|
...
|
@@ -181,9 +191,11 @@ func (translator *UserTranslator) ToUserFromRepresentation(user *UserDetail) (*d |
|
|
Org: nil,
|
|
|
Orgs: nil,
|
|
|
Department: nil,
|
|
|
Role: nil,
|
|
|
Roles: nil,
|
|
|
UserInfo: nil,
|
|
|
UserType: 0,
|
|
|
UserName: user.UserInfo.UserName,
|
|
|
UserPhone: user.UserInfo.Phone,
|
|
|
Status: 0,
|
|
|
Company: nil,
|
|
|
}, nil
|
...
|
...
|
|